Who Books This?

Hosted by comedians Jeremy Cangiano and Liz Miller, Who Books This? is a deep dive into the comedy and entertainment industries, tackling the ins and outs of getting booked—and the mistakes that can make you unbookable.From stand-up comics to musicians, actors, dancers, and even fitness instructors, anyone performing on a stage will relate to the struggle of securing gigs. Each episode features industry guests (and plenty of hilarious stories) as we break down:✅ The dos & don’ts of booking✅ How to navigate the industry as a new or seasoned performer✅ Wild tales from the road—both wins and horror storiesIf you’ve ever asked, “Who books this?”—this podcast is for you.🎧 New episodes drop biweekly!
